Hanroth is a municipality in the Neuwied district in the north of Rhineland-Palatinate . She belongs to the Verbandsgemeinde Puderbach .

geography

The place is a little off the main traffic arteries south of Puderbach on the edge of the Rhine-Westerwald nature park . The village stretches for about a kilometer in an east-west direction along the Hanrother Bach and falls to the west into the valley of the Holzbach . At the mouth of the Hanrother Bach is the district of Hanroth Süd (Hedwigsthal) .

history

The place was first mentioned in 1450 as Hoenrode .

politics

Municipal council

The municipal council in Hanroth consists of twelve council members, who were elected by a majority vote in the local elections on May 26, 2019 , and the honorary local mayor as chairman.

mayor

Claus Keller became the local mayor of Hanroth on August 21, 2019. Since there was no candidate in the direct election on May 26, 2019, he was elected by the local council for five years. His predecessor was Diethelm Stein.

coat of arms

Hanroth coat of arms
Blazon : “Split; in front four red slanting bars in silver, covered by a blue peacock turned to the left; in the back in silver on top three red roses next to each other, underneath a tilted and propped red sword. "
Justification of the coat of arms: The Wied coat of arms, peacock and sloping bar, indicate that Hanroth belonged to the upper county of Wied-Runkel (until 1806), which was formerly Isenburg territory. Therefore, instead of the wied colors red and gold, the Isenburg colors red and silver appear. Roses and swords are the emblems of the knights of Raubach , bailiffs of the lords of Isenburg. Hanroth belonged to the Raubach Vogtei. The coat of arms has been legally valid since April 7, 1977, based on a design by Ernst Zeiler, Raubach.
